| Rabbit in the Moon |
 | The electronica outfit Rabbit in the Moon, comprised of Dave Christophere,
"Monk" and "Bunny," is one of the hottest groups on today's scene. Combining the blends of world beat samples with Florida deep house create a unique sound all its own. Their live performances are legendary and they continue to pack the house with their marathon sets at raves around the globe.

| Gangstarr - Exclusive Interview |
 | Since debuting in 1986, Gangstarr has consistently ranked among hip hop's most respected. Check out Pseudo's exclusive interview with Guru and DJ Premier of Gangstarr. This interview will leave you laying "Right Where You Stand".
